Daniel Wolf: Joining the Nets is like a dream come true, Brooklyn is one of the best cities in the world
June 26th NBA 2025 Draft, Danny Wolf from the University of Michigan was selected by the Nets with the 27th pick. Wolf talked about his views on the Nets and Brooklyn in an interview: "The first impression is that being here is like a dream come true. Brooklyn is an incredible place, one of the best cities in the world. It has excellent management and a good coaching team. I really like the direction of the team's current development. "At the same time, I'm very excited to be here. It was an incredible opportunity and I was so happy to come to Brooklyn and call it my home. ”
